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will conduct a thorough assessment of the damage to your hardwood floors, using advanced equipment to find out the extent of the damage and create a personalized plan for repair. This step typically takes 30 minutes to 1 hour and is crucial in preventing further damage. We’ll work with you to identify the source of the leak and create a plan to mitigate future damage.
Step 2: Extraction and Drying
Using industrial-grade equipment, such as submersible pumps and high-velocity dryers we’ll extract excess water from your hardwood floors and begin the drying process. This step typically takes 2-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. We’ll monitor moisture levels closely to ensure thorough drying and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Cleaning and Disinfecting
Once the drying process is complete, our team will clean and disinfect your hardwood floors to remove any remaining dirt, debris, or bacteria. This step is crucial in preventing the growth of mold and mildew, which can cause further damage and health risks.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 4: Repair and Refinishing
Finally, our team will repair any damaged boards or planks and refinish your hardwood floors to their original beauty. This step typically takes 1-3 days, depending on the extent of the damage and the type of finish required. We’ll use high-quality materials and expert craftsmanship to ensure a lasting result.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ill | Yes | No | You can likely clean and dry the area yourself. |
| Large water spill |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are needed to prevent further damage. |
| Visible water stains | No | Yes | Stains can be a sign of further damage and costly repairs. |
| Warped or rotting wood | No | Yes | Severe damage needs professional repair or replacement. |
| Musty odors | No | Yes | Odors can be a sign of mold and mildew growth, which can cause serious health risks. |
| Buckled or cupped boards | No | Yes | These signs can show further damage and costly repairs. |

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ost In Randallstown, MD
The cost of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Randallstown, MD. These are estimates, not guarantees. Get a free estimate to find out the exact cost of your project.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$300 – $1,000 | Type of finish, size of affected area |
| Repair or Replacement | $1,000 – $3,000 | Extent of damage, type of wood |
| Refinishing | $500 – $2,000 | Type of finish, size of affected area |
| Moisture Testing and Inspection |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Emergency Response | $0 – $500 | Time of day, severity of damage |
